The Micro Incinerator operates on the principle of rapid thermal sterilization, utilizing infrared heat emitted from a ceramic heating chamber. This enclosed ceramic tube generates consistent, high-temperature disinfection that is both efficient and safe. Unlike traditional flame sterilizers such as alcohol lamps and Bunsen burners, infrared sterilizers drastically reduce the risk of sample contamination through controlled thermal disinfection.<\/p>\n<p><\/p>\n<p>With a high-temperature range, the Micro Incinerator can achieve effective sterilization in mere seconds, making it an optimal choice for busy laboratory environments. The precise heat control minimizes the potential for aerosol generation, ensuring clean-bench-safe operations even in the most sensitive microbial handling scenarios.<\/p>\n<p><\/p>\n<h2>Applications in Real Laboratories<\/h2>\n<p><\/p>\n<p>The Micro Incinerator is rapidly becoming a staple in various laboratory settings within Japan&#8217;s healthcare and educational institutions.
